This comment adds (1) basic support for AF_BLUETOOTH sockets. The logic compiles but is still incomplete. Support for Bluetooth is general is still dependent on CONFIG_EXPERMIMENTAL because it is not yet ready for used.
Squashed commit of the following:
wireless/bluetooth: Some small changes that gets to a clean compile by just eliminating some incorrect implementations (still with a lot of warnings. The logic is still incomplete but now not so lethal.
wireless/bluetooth: Restructuring: Connection interfaces should internal to wireless/bluetooth. include/nuttx/wireless/bt_conn.h removed and merged with wireless/bluetooth/bt_conn.h. Several fix to get closer to bt_netdev.c compiling. Need to design some not interfaces and use some existing interfaces to send and receiv packets.
wireless/bluetooth: Some organization with some network device compile errors fixed. Still not even close to compiling.
net/bluetooth: Fix numerous compile issues; Still open design issues with regard to the interface with the Bluetooth stack.
wireless/bluetooth: Create bt_netdev.c with a crude copy of mac802154_netdev.c. Does not not even compile yet.
include/nuttx/net: Add bluetooth.h. Content is not yet correct.
net/netpackets: Add bluetooth.h. Update net/bluetooth to use new socket address definition.
net/bluetooth: Some fixes for initial build.
net/bluetooth: Add initial support for Bluetooth sockets. The initial cut is just the a clone of the IEEE 802.15.4 socket support with name changes.
net/ieee802154: Fix some typos noted when cloning to create net/bluetooth.
